代码之家  ›  专栏  ›  技术社区  ›  André Hoffmann

结合phpdocumentor在docbook手册中集成图像

  •  1
  • André Hoffmann  · 技术社区  · 15 年前

    是否有可能将图像包含在phpdocumentor编写的docbook手册中?

    我都试过了:

    <mediaobject>
     <imageobject>
      <imagedata fileref="payment_flowchart.png" format="png"/> 
     </imageobject>
    </mediaobject>
    

    还有:

    <figure><title>foo</title>
     <graphic fileref="payment_flowchart.png"/>
    </figure>
    

    再说一次,我尝试的图像路径可能不是phpdocumentor所期望的,但我不知道到底该把它们放在哪里。

    也许有人曾经尝试过,并取得了更大的成功?

    更新

    当前非工作方法:

    <refentry id="{@id}">
     <refnamediv>
      <refname>Company_Payment</refname>
     </refnamediv>
     <refsynopsisdiv>
      <author>
       Company
       <authorblurb>
        {@link mailto:my@mail.com André Hoffmann}
       </authorblurb>
      </author>
     </refsynopsisdiv>
     {@toc}
     <refsect1 id="{@id about}">
      <title>About</title>
      <para>
       text
       <imagedata fileref="/Users/andre/Zend/workspaces/DefaultWorkspace7/payment/doc/tutorials/company/payment_flowchart.png" format="PNG"/> 
      </para>
      <imagedata fileref="/Users/andre/Zend/workspaces/DefaultWorkspace7/payment/doc/tutorials/company/payment_flowchart.png" format="PNG"/> 
    <mediaobject>
        <imageobject>
        <imagedata fileref="/Users/andre/Zend/workspaces/DefaultWorkspace7/payment/doc/tutorials/company/payment_flowchart.png" format="PNG"/> 
        </imageobject>
    </mediaobject>
        <figure><title>foo</title>
            <graphic srccredit="Norman Walsh, 1998" fileref="/Users/andre/Zend/workspaces/DefaultWorkspace7/payment/doc/tutorials/company/payment_flowchart.png"/>
        </figure>
     </refsect1>
    ...
    
    2 回复  |  直到 14 年前
        1
  •  0
  •   Phill Pafford    15 年前

    我想他们把它修好了 1.3.0 使用 <graphic/> 标签。你在运行哪个版本?

        2
  •  0
  •   Nev Stokes    15 年前

    我取得了一些成功,但只是在删除srccredit属性之后。用包装标签没有什么区别。

    简单地说:

    <graphic fileref="/images/logo.png" />